Transaction 254e63f0508fd0085998c2b878d01921f88edd41b5dfef9723de40acae1cd434

1 Input
2 Outputs
  • 254e63f0508fd0085998c2b878d01921f88edd41b5dfef9723de40acae1cd434:0
  • value  10689053
    address  3Hv23r2HqpVYaHWaq7dbJJXhb4ipsztsiY
  • 254e63f0508fd0085998c2b878d01921f88edd41b5dfef9723de40acae1cd434:1
  • value  1485554
    address  19NkADB3bBPk4PJz9qzXcm1bQ2JdjL3iXr